contribution in e+ + e- p + p at small s

Abstract

Two-photon annihilate contributions in the process e+ + e- p + p including N and intermediate are discussed in a simple hadronic model. The corrections to the unpolarized cross section and polarized observables Px,Pz are presented. The results show the two-photon annihilate correction to unpolarized cross section is small and its angle dependence becomes weak at small s after considering the N and (1232) contributions simultaneously, while the correction to Pz is enhanced.
